The Role
We're looking for an SEO/GEO Specialist to lead organic and AI search visibility work across our client engagements. This is a hands-on, client-facing role: you'll run audits, build strategies, present findings directly to brand stakeholders, and own the ongoing work that moves the needle on both traditional search and AI-driven discovery.
The way we think about it: roughly 80% of what works for SEO is exactly what works for GEO — and the other 20% is a new discipline entirely. You'll need to be strong on the fundamentals (technical SEO, content strategy, site architecture) while staying on the forefront of how LLMs like ChatGPT, Perplexity, Gemini, and Claude discover, cite, and recommend brands. We treat LLMs as another customer: how a brand presents information to them is now as important as how it presents to people.
Our clients are CPG brands navigating an omnichannel reality — DTC, retail, Amazon, and beyond. You'll often be advising brands whose conversions happen off their own site, which means you need to think about visibility and brand authority, not just rankings and traffic.
Responsibilities
- Conduct comprehensive SEO/GEO audits covering technical SEO (schema and structured data, redirects, canonicals, site architecture, broken backlinks), organic performance analysis, and competitive visibility benchmarking
- Run our GEO methodology end-to-end: develop test prompts from high-intent keywords, track brand mentions, sentiment, and share of voice across LLMs using prompt-tracking tools, and identify the third-party sources informing AI answers
- Translate audit findings into prioritized, realistic recommendations — quick wins through larger initiatives — tailored to each client's resources and business goals
- Develop and guide offsite visibility strategies including digital PR direction, Reddit and UGC engagement, editorial citations, and third-party profile optimization
- Lead ongoing client engagements: monthly syncs, quarterly strategy sessions, content brief development, PDP and collection page optimization, and performance reporting (organic KPIs, AI referral traffic, GEO share of voice)
- Present audits and strategy directly to senior client stakeholders, explaining complex and evolving concepts in plain, confident language
- Support new business by contributing audits, methodology walkthroughs, and strategic POVs to pitches and proposals
- Advise on SEO/GEO implications of site redesigns and platform migrations, including URL transition planning, in partnership with our design and engineering teams
- Stay ahead of how AI search is evolving — separating signal from noise — and feed that thinking back into Barrel's methodology, service offerings, and thought leadership
